Author Study: J.K. Rowling

I was thrilled when I found out I was appointed to J.K. Rowling as my author! J.K. Rowling is my absolute favorite author, and I can not wait to dig deeper into her writing style. As a child, I grew up adoring the Harry Potter series. I still love it just as much today. The writing style, character development, and originality are a few of the reasons why I enjoyed reading these books. J.K. Rowling has a simple writing style that caters to elementary aged students. Students may be intimidated by the size of the books, but once you begin reading, the books fly by!
As a teacher, I want my students to be able to fall in love with a book series like I did as a student. Whether it be Harry Potter, or something completely different, I would love for my students to find a book series they can fall in love with. Reading a book series they enjoy may spark an interest in other types of books. I had favorite authors growing up, and I hope my students can find many favorites as well. I will want to have a very diverse library in my classroom that enables every student to find a book they are interested in.
